avuncular
avuncular — 形容詞
- avuncularpositive
- more avuncularcomparative
- most avuncularsuperlative
1. showing the warm, reassuring manner people often connect with a caring uncle

用法筆記
Usually describes a person's manner rather than an actual family relationship. It often appears with nouns such as smile, tone, or manner, and suggests calm authority as well as kindness.

用法筆記
Mainly seen in legal, historical, or anthropological writing. It usually modifies nouns such as relationship, rights, duties, or authority, rather than describing somebody's personality.
